複數與幾何


複數是中學代數課程中數的概念最後1次擴展.初學複數時,對它的存在往往會感到懷疑,認爲它是虛無縹緲的數.事實上,複數的應用非常廣泛,特別是在幾何中的應用.本文利用複數來研究幾何,主要考慮如下的問題:平面上的點集的複數表示;平面曲線的複數表示;複數在共線、共點、共圓、複數的.麥比烏斯變換等幾何問題上的應用,在說明這些應用的同時介紹1些數學上常用的思考方法.
